Why Port Lavaca is Perfect for Winter Texans
Port Lavaca offers the ideal combination of mild winter weather, coastal charm, and affordable living that Winter Texans crave. Located on Matagorda Bay with easy access to the Gulf of Mexico, this historic coastal town provides:
- Mild Winter Climate: Average winter temperatures in the 60s-70s°F
- Excellent Fishing: Year-round access to trout, redfish, and flounder
- Rich History: Explore the Calhoun County Museum and La Salle Monument
- Natural Beauty: Magnolia Beach – the only natural shell beach on the Texas coast
- Affordable Living: Lower cost of living compared to other coastal destinations
- Convenient Location: Easy access to larger cities while maintaining small-town charm

Local Attractions & Activities for Winter Texans
Fishing & Water Activities
- Indianola Fishing Marina: Complete fishing accommodations with live bait, boat launch, and restaurant
- Magnolia Beach: Natural shell beach perfect for beachcombing and relaxation
- Fishing Pier Park: Family-friendly fishing right in Port Lavaca
- Matagorda Bay: Excellent winter fishing for trout, redfish, and flounder
Historical & Cultural Sites
- Calhoun County Museum: Rich local history and maritime heritage
- La Salle Monument: Historic landmark commemorating French exploration
- Half Moon Reef Lighthouse: Iconic coastal landmark and photo opportunity
- Lighthouse Beach: Scenic waterfront area perfect for walks
Dining & Shopping
- Lighthouse Seafood: Fresh local seafood and coastal cuisine
- Indianola Marina Restaurant: Waterfront dining with fishing access
- Local Grocery Options: Convenient shopping near most RV parks
- Melcher’s Hardware Store: Historic local business for RV supplies

Planning Your 2026 Winter Texan Stay
Best Time to Arrive
The ideal time for Winter Texans to arrive in Port Lavaca is typically November through March, when northern weather becomes harsh and Texas coastal weather remains mild and pleasant.
What to Bring
- Light jackets for occasional cool fronts
- Fishing gear for excellent winter fishing
- Bicycles for beach access and local exploration
- Outdoor furniture for enjoying the mild weather
Booking Recommendations
- Book Early: Popular spots fill up quickly during peak Winter Texan season
- Consider Monthly Rates: Significant savings for stays over 4 weeks
- Ask About Concrete Pads: Better for longer stays and RV stability
- Verify Pet Policies: Ensure your furry companions are welcome
